### Image Analyst Definition:

An Image Analyst is a professional who specializes in examining and interpreting visual data, such as images and videos, to derive meaningful insights and actionable information. These experts utilize advanced technology, software tools, and analytical techniques to process and analyze visual content. Image Analysts are employed in a variety of fields, including remote sensing, medical imaging, surveillance, and computer vision, where their expertise is critical for understanding and interpreting complex visual data.

 

### Image Analyst Meaning:

The term "Image Analyst" refers to an individual with a deep understanding of image processing techniques, computer algorithms, and statistical methods, enabling them to analyze images with precision and accuracy. Image Analysts decode visual information, identify patterns, detect anomalies, and provide data-driven insights that are crucial for decision-making in various industries. Their role is pivotal in transforming raw visual data into actionable knowledge.

### Duties of an Image Analyst:

Image Analysts perform a range of duties related to image processing, analysis, and data interpretation, including:

 

1. **Data Collection:** Collects and gathers image data from various sources, such as satellite imagery, medical scans, or surveillance footage.

2. **Image Preprocessing:** Prepares images for analysis by cleaning, enhancing, and aligning features, removing noise, and adjusting contrast.

3. **Algorithm Implementation:** Develops and applies algorithms for image segmentation, object detection, classification, and feature extraction.

4. **Feature Identification:** Identifies and defines relevant features, structures, and patterns within images.

5. **Model Training:** Trains machine learning models using labeled data for tasks like object recognition or semantic segmentation.

6. **Quality Control:** Ensures data accuracy and validates analysis results by comparing findings with ground truth or expert knowledge.

7. **Performance Evaluation:** Assesses the performance of algorithms and models, measuring metrics like accuracy, precision, and recall.

8. **Customization:** Adapts existing image analysis techniques to specific use cases, tailoring solutions for unique challenges.

9. **Data Visualization:** Presents analysis results using visualizations, graphs, and charts to effectively communicate insights.

 

### Tasks of an Image Analyst:

Image Analysts perform various tasks to achieve precise image analysis, including:

 

1. **Image Enhancement:** Applies techniques to improve the clarity and visibility of important features in images.

2. **Segmentation:** Divides images into distinct regions or objects to isolate specific areas of interest.

3. **Classification:** Assigns labels or categories to objects within images based on their characteristics.

4. **Object Detection:** Detects and locates objects of interest within images, such as vehicles or buildings.

5. **Feature Extraction:** Extracts relevant features from images, including texture, color, shape, or spatial arrangement.

6. **Data Annotation:** Annotates images with labels and markings to create training datasets for machine learning models.

7. **Model Tuning:** Fine-tunes machine learning models to optimize performance on specific image analysis tasks.

8. **Troubleshooting:** Resolves issues that arise during image analysis, such as algorithm errors or data inconsistencies.

9. **Continuous Learning:** Keeps up with advancements in image analysis techniques, machine learning, and computer vision.
